是的,您的说法非常准确。在现代软件开发中,后端开发和前端开发都是至关重要的角色,他们各自拥有独特的优势和重要性。 前端开发主要关注软件的用户界面和交互体验。前端开发者负责设计并构建用户与软件交互的界面,他们需要掌握HTML、CSS和JavaScript等前端技术,以确保网页或应用程序的界面具有吸引力、易用性和响应速度。他们需要理解用户体验设计原则,并能够与设计师紧密合作,以创造出令人愉悦的用户界面。 后端开发则更侧重于服务器的开发和数据管理。后端开发者负责设计和构建软件的服务器端架构,处理数据的存储、检索和交互逻辑。他们需要掌握服务器端编程语言(如Java、Python、Ruby等)以及数据库技术,以确保服务器能够高效地处理请求并返回相应的数据。后端开发还需要处理数据的安全性、稳定性和可扩展性等方面的问题。 在软件开发过程中,前端开发和后端开发是相互依存的。前端开发者需要与后端开发者紧密合作,以确保界面与服务器端的交互顺畅并为用户提供良好的体验。他们共同协作,共同解决开发过程中遇到的问题,确保软件项目的成功实施。 总的来说,前端开发和后端开发在软件开发中各自扮演着重要的角色。前端开发关注用户界面的设计和交互体验,而后端开发则关注服务器端的开发和数据管理。他们共同协作,以确保软件项目的成功实施,并为用户提供高质量的软件体验。
确实,随着数字化时代的来临,后端开发在构建和维护各种应用、系统和平台中扮演着至关重要的角色。现如今,不论是互联网还是移动应用领域,都对后端开发有着巨大的需求。这种需求来源于企业对稳定、高效、安全的系统和服务的需求。在这样的背景下,优秀的后端开发者无疑拥有广阔的就业前景。 对于想要从事后端开发的人来说,掌握编程语言如Java、Python、PHP等是基础,同时还需要熟悉数据库管理、服务器架构、网络通信等知识。此外,随着云计算和大数据的兴起,对后端开发者的要求也越来越高,需要具备处理海量数据和云计算的能力。 除了专业技能,良好的团队协作能力、问题解决能力和持续学习的态度也是后端开发者必备的素质。在这个领域,只有不断学习新技术和适应行业变化,才能保持竞争力。 当然,与需求相匹配的是相对较高的薪酬。优秀的后端开发者往往能够获得较高的薪资和福利待遇。而且,随着经验的积累和技术水平的提升,他们的职业道路也会越来越宽广。除了成为一名全职开发者,还可以选择成为项目经理、架构师或自己创业等。 总之,后端开发是一个充满机遇和挑战的领域。如果你对这个领域感兴趣并具备相应的技能,那么不妨勇敢追求你的梦想,未来的道路将会充满无限可能。
随着数字世界的不断扩张和用户需求的日益增长,前端开发的重要性愈发凸显。一个好的前端开发者,不仅仅是技术的执行者,更是创意的诠释者。他们能将设计师的天马行空化为触手可及,为用户带来流畅、直观、富有吸引力的操作体验。
在当下竞争激烈的市场环境中,前端开发者需要掌握的技能越来越多样化。他们不仅要熟练掌握基础的HTML、CSS和JavaScript,还要对性能优化、响应式设计、交互设计等方面有深入的了解。此外,随着技术的发展,前端开发者还需要对新兴技术保持敏感,如人工智能、物联网等,以便能为用户提供更加智能、便捷的服务。
这些优秀的前端开发者,他们的每一次创新都是为了提升用户的满意度和忠诚度。他们深知用户体验的重要性,始终坚持以用户为中心的设计理念,不断优化产品的易用性和友好性。无论是页面的布局、动画的效果,还是交互的流程,他们都力求做到极致,让用户在使用产品时感受到愉悦和满足。
在这个变化莫测的时代,前端开发者需要不断学习和进步,以应对市场的变化和用户的需求。只有这样,才能为用户提供更加优质的产品和服务,推动整个行业的进步。互联网前端开发的就业前景也很好。

没错,确实如此。后端开发和前端开发在现代软件开发中都是不可或缺的角色。后端开发主要负责数据处理、业务逻辑和与数据库的交互等,需要掌握编程语言如Java、Python等以及相关的框架和工具。而前端开发则专注于用户界面设计和用户体验,涉及HTML、CSS、JavaScript等技术,注重页面的交互性和用户友好性。两者各有千秋,选择哪个方向更好要根据个人兴趣、技能和职业目标来决定。不过,随着技术的发展和互联网的普及,两个领域都有着广阔的就业前景。而且,一个优秀的软件开发团队需要后端和前端开发的协同合作,才能构建出优秀的应用程序。

1. 技能要求区别:后端开发主要涉及服务器端的编程和数据处理。常见的后端语言包括Java、Python、C#等。后端开发需要一定的编程和算法基础,对数据库和网络通信有一定的了解。而前端开发主要涉及网站或应用程序的用户界面和用户交互。常见的前端技术包括HTML、CSS和JavaScript等。前端开发需要具备良好的设计和用户体验的意识,对网页布局和响应式设计有一定的了解。
工作职责大解析:后端开发专注数据处理、业务逻辑实现和数据库管理,确保服务器稳定安全,应对海量数据挑战;前端开发则致力于打造用户体验,将设计转化为生动界面,用HTML、CSS和JavaScript等技术实现用户与界面的流畅互动。
人气课程排行
1. 打开微信扫一扫,扫描左侧二维码
2. 添加老师微信,马上领取免费课程资源